Online & Distance Learning at Highline College
Many students take online classes at Highline College. Of 5,592 students, 2,081 (37%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 1,915 (34%) took at least some classes online.

Animation & Special Effects Associate’s Program at Highline College
Among the 7 associate’s animation & special effects degrees awarded at Highline College, 43% were women (3) and 57% were men (4).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Animation & Special Effects associate’s degree recipients at Highline College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 3 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
| Asian | 1 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
Minority students account for 57% of Animation & Special Effects associate’s degree recipients at Highline College, higher than the national average of 56%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
